预成金属桩和纤维桩固位影响因素的剪切粘接实验

摘    要:目的:比较纤维桩和预成金属桩使用不同粘接系统时根管各部的剪切粘接强度。方法:自制相同尺寸的碳纤维桩、预成金属桩,分别与全酸蚀系统ONE-STEP/C&B CEMENT或自粘接系统Rely X Unicem在人上颌中切牙根管内(n=6),用Synergie综合测试仪对各根管段行剪切粘接实验,行裂区方差分析。结果:剪切粘接强度分别为:纤维桩全酸蚀组:(11.14±1.26)MPa,纤维桩自粘接组:(5.04±0.94)MPa,金属桩全酸蚀组:(13.62±1.16)MPa,金属桩自粘接组:(7.80±1.36)MPa。预成金属桩剪切粘接强度优于碳纤维桩(P<0.000 1),全酸蚀系统优于自粘接系统(P<0.000 1)。根管各段由冠方向根方剪切粘接强度逐渐减弱。结论:预成桩修复的剪切粘接强度受桩材质、粘接系统及根管不同部位等因素的影响。

关 键 词:预成桩  固位  剪切粘接实验

Evaluation of the factors affecting retention of fiber posts and prefabricated metal posts using push-out test

Abstract:Objective: To investigate the shear bond strength between different prefabricated posts and root canals using different adhesive systems.Methods: C-posts and KF-posts were placed into canals of manxillary central incisors using one step-plus/C&B cement(OSP/CB) and Rely X Unicem(RXU) adhesive systems respectively(n=6).The push-out test was performed on different sections of the roots by Synergie tester.The data were analyzed with split-plot ANOVA.Results: The average push-out strengths of C-post with OSP/CB,...
Keywords:Prefabricated post  Retention  Push-out test
